In Memoriam: Dennis Etchison 1943 – 2019

Dennis Etchison - World Horror Convention 2008

Dennis Etchison (March 30, 1943 – May 28, 2019) On Tuesday May 28th, the American horror writer and editor Dennis Etchison passed away.
